Chalcones and coumarins are important naturally occurring plant constituents and display a wide range of pharmacological and biological activities. In an environmentally benign approach, synthesis of biphenyl chalcone and coumarin derivatives was successfully accomplished via Suzuki coupling by using PEG-400 as a solvent under microwave irradiation.
